Hope it wasn't Capt Hollywood, i think he flies for these guys. From the ATSB site. While conducting sling load operations, the load at the end of the long line became tangled. The pilot attempted to land the helicopter, however when at about 10 ft above ground level, the line pulled tight. The pilot was unable to release the line, and the helicopter collided with terrain, resulting in substantial damage. The pilot received minor injuries. |

Aircraft details Aircraft manufacturer: Bell Helicopter Co Aircraft model: 206L-3 Aircraft registration: VH-NKW Serial number: 51463 Type of operation: Aerial Work Sector: Helicopter Damage to aircraft: Substantial Departure point: Scotia 3D Seismic Camp, Qld |
